| Subject: [PATCH 160/286] clk: renesas: r8a7795: Add support for R-Car H3 ES2.0 |
| |
| The Clock Pulse Generator / Module Standby and Software Reset module in |
| R-Car H3 ES2.0 differs from ES1.x in the following areas: |
| - More core clocks (S0D2, S0D3, S0D6, S0D8, S0D12), |
| - Different parent clocks for AUDMAC, EtherAVB, FCP, FDP, IMR, |
| SYS-DMAC, VIN, VSPB, VSPI, |
| - Removal of modules CSI21, FCPCI, FCPF2, FCPVD3, FCPVI2, FDP1-2, |
| USB3-IF1, VSPD3, VSPI2, |
| - Addition of modules EHCI3, HS-USB-IF3, USB-DMAC3-0, USB-DMAC3-1. |
| |
| The goal is twofold: |
| 1. Support both the ES1.x and ES2.0 SoC revisions in a single binary |
| for now, |
| 2. Make it clear which code supports ES1.x, so it can easily be |
| identified and removed later, when production SoCs are deemed |
| ubiquitous. |
| |
| This is achieved by: |
| - Updating the clock tables for the latest revision (ES2.0), but not |
| removing clocks that only exist on earlier revisions (ES1.x), |
| - Detecting the SoC revision at runtime using the new soc_device_match() |
| API, and fixing up the clocks tables to match the actual SoC |
| revision, by: |
| - NULLifying core and module clocks of modules that do not exist, |
| - Reparenting module clocks that have a different parent on ES1.x. |
| |
| Based on R-Car Gen3 Hardware User's Manual rev. 0.53E. |
